LASER SYSTEM FOR INITIAL CORRECTION OF HEADING OF FLYING VEHICLE AT PARKING APRON

FIELD: aviation navigation. SUBSTANCE: laser system for initial correction of heading of flying vehicle at parking apron includes transceiver installed outside of flying vehicle and optical prismatic reflector made fast to adjustment fixture 8 anchored on body of flying vehicle. Angle 90°+ γ at vertex of prismatic reflector is realized depending on condition , where δ is value of deviation of reflected beam with respect to incident beam; D is distance between reflector and transceiver. Carrier 18 is attached to front strut of landing gear forming kinematic lever pair. EFFECT: enhanced accuracy and noise immunity, ensured all-weather capability and reduced time of preparation of flying vehicle for take-off. 2 cl, 3 dwg
